  2. The backward curved heel, AFAIK, has been around since 1959, when it was first designed by Roger Vivier ("Talon choc"/"Shock Heel"). Vivier was one of the of the most original and influential shoe designer, so, modern designers tend to sort of pay hommage to him from time to time. The result is not always very convincing.

  5. The pair in the first pic is really sky high (at least, more than the usual we are used to see) or is just an effect caused by the shot angle?

    These are Jimmy Choo's Esam platform pumps, with 5 3/4" / 14,5 cm heels with 1 1/2" / 4 cm platform. So, indeed, the heel is higher than usual, but the angle of the shot makes them look even higher.
